What's Happening?
Mews, a hospitality management platform, has acquired Flexkeeping, a company specializing in automation tools for hotel housekeeping. Established in 2012, Flexkeeping offers features such as automated room assignments, cleaning plans, and real-time task management. This acquisition aims to integrate these tools into Mews' existing system, enhancing operational efficiency and staff collaboration. The integration is expected to connect housekeeping, maintenance, and front desk teams through shared checklists and centralized task tracking. Flexkeeping's technology has reportedly increased productivity by 40% and reduced guest complaints by 45% in various properties worldwide.
